| Phase | Typical Timeline | Key Tasks |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Planning | 12+ Months Out | Budget, Guest List, Venue, Date |
| Vendor Booking | 9-12 Months Out | Photographer, Caterer, DJ, Dress |
| Logistics | 6-9 Months Out | Save-the-Dates, Hotel Blocks, Honeymoon |
| Refining the Plan | 4-6 Months Out | Invitations, Ceremony, Reception |
| Final Touches | 2-4 Months Out | Vendor Contracts, Marriage License |
